What This Means for UK Casino Players
Although the allure of platforms like Pulsz is understandable, UK players should carefully evaluate the associated risks. The absence of UKGC oversight can jeopardize player protections, impacting dispute resolution and fund security. Opting for UKGC-licensed operators is advisable, as these platforms provide a more secure gambling environment. For those considering unlicensed options, exercising caution and thoroughly understanding the terms and conditions is essential.
